Role of Exercise in a Diet

exercisedietSometimes people wonder about the role of exercise in a diet. They ask if it is really necessary, and they wonder if using an extreme diet alone can lead to weight loss without the need for exercising.

There may be a few who question to role of exercise in a diet, but in reality, the only way to successfully lose weight and keep it off is to include both diet and exercise.

If you really don't mind dieting and limiting your food intake, then you may tilt your weight management program in favor of dieting, of if you love your food and don't mind a good workout, then you might do more exercise. But you do need some of both to be successful in the long term.

The best formula for long term success in weight loss is to modify long term behavior so that it includes regular exercise and sustainable changes in your regular diet.

For a person who is in the obese category, even a simple increase in physical activity can mean great strides in weight loss. The role of exercise in weight loss can be incredible.

You should work with your doctor before starting a dramatic weight loss program, but you can make simple changes easily and immediately.

Walking around the block once a day at first may be all you can handle, but you'll be able to progressively increase the amount of exercise as your body becomes used to it. You can progressively increase the amount of exercise you do as you become more physically fit.

Not only is the role of exercise in a diet very important, but the role of exercise in your mental health and outlook on life is also vital. Exercise is a cathartic activity, and can be a great way to cope with stress and routine.

It also releases endorphins, which are hormones that lead to positive attitudes and thoughts, which can be a significant boost in your life.

Another reason the role of exercise in diet is so important is that many of the physical benefits you receive from dieting are increased with appropriate exercise.

For example, heart problems, diabetes, osteoporosis and high blood pressure are all made worse by too much weight. While losing weight alone does improve the situation, to really decrease the instances of these diseases and prevent them from taking over, then exercise is vital.

Cardiovascular health is dependent on good exercise, muscle strength and fitness. Osteoporosis has been shown to decrease as you exercise. Diabetes symptoms decrease more rapidly with exercise.

Perhaps the most important reason to increase the role of exercise in diet is that you will lose weight much more quickly if you combine both diet and exercise than if you focus on either one alone.

Working together, diet and exercise increase your health, your physical condition, your life expectancy, and your sense of well being all while dropping your weight.

Is there any reason, then, to ignore the role of exercise in a diet? None at all! Start simply, and make it a lifestyle change that you can live with --- for a long time.
